Description of book

The main theme of this story is love and marriage. Herbert Onslow, a young English bank clerk, works in Munich for a German bank owned by the Heine Brothers. The younger Heine branch takes the young British man into their homes, where he falls in love with the eldest sister, Isa Heine. But this isn't England: Isa is a cool-headed young lady who refuses to marry until Herbert has proven that he can run a separate household. These rules are reinforced by Isa's family. Herbert will be made a partner in Heine Brothers within four years unless he can get some money from his family. Will Herbert Onslow make partners? Will Isa finally agree to marry him?
